Hi

I wonder where the Internet Radio setup file is located, so i can backup the file or edit the radiostation list on a pc?

I have made a copy of \home\user to my pc and done some searching, but did not located it in there.

Code:
/home/user/.mafw.db
or so I believe

HA

PS You will need to determine the db format here in order to edit as it is a binary file

Originally Posted by handaxe View Post
PS You will need to determine the db format here in order to edit as it is a binary file
It's a plain SQLite3 database file:
Code:
sqlite3 /home/user/.mafw.db "SELECT * FROM iradiobookmarks"
